Tradition and reception in Arabic literature, 2019: title page (edited by Margaret Larkin and Jocelyn Sharlet) page 262-263 (Margaret Larkin; Ph. D. in Arabic from the Department of Middle East Languages and Cultures at Columbia University; studied at the American University in Cairo; Professor of Arabic Literature in the Department of Near Eastern Studies at the University of California, Berkeley; published on classical Arabic poetry and rhetoric, Mamluk-era Arabic literature, especially popular poetry; she was named the Bayard Dodge Distinguished Visiting Professor in the Department of Arab and Islamic Civilizations at the American University in Cairo in 2010)
Near Eastern Studies, UC Berkely, viewed November 20, 2019 (Professor Margaret Larkin; Ph. D. (Columbia University, 1989); work covers the classical and modern periods and deals with texts composed in both literary Arabic and Egyptian colloquial Arabic)
